logo

Output 103ac555ba8dc7ecf2e8b44f7631f4404700b1dbfc965ef2396852bd0ba21461: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f153aa8046f89ab6aca316a5c878160c12a61887 OP_EQUAL
address
3Ph2zzUrs6uBymJRVHCUvTCJ74URkCqZT3
transaction
103ac555ba8dc7ecf2e8b44f7631f4404700b1dbfc965ef2396852bd0ba21461